What Triggers Plantar Fasciitis?

Non-supportive Shoes. If you’re putting on a shoe that’s old as well as has put on locations on the heels or soles, that’s a great indicator troubles loom.
No Shoes. Like me. I just determined a bit of exercise in bare feet wouldn’t harm me and also yet one-time was all it took. Whether working out or strolling barefoot on hard surface areas, the threat is the same.
Weight Gain. Also natural weight gain as experienced during pregnancy can set off fallen arches or added anxiety to the plantar fascia. And I had actually placed a couple of additional pounds on over the winter months.
Overuse. Some professional athletes that duplicate the very same motions or overuse their feet are revealed to problems that can come to be Plantar Fasciitis. On top of that, those that stand in put on a hard surface or execute repeated activities at work are at a high threat of establishing Plantar Fasciitis.
High Heels and Flip-Flops. Both of these types of shoes are fine in moderation. However, extensive usage in time can tighten calf bone muscular tissues (high heels) or bring about fallen arcs (flip-flops).
Being 50 And Over. After 50, the feet and also heels can show more deterioration, as well as can become completely dry and fragile which permits the plantar fascia to be damaged.

Just How Will I Know If I’m Struggling With Plantar Fasciitis?

If you experience sharp pain upon rising in the morning as well as if it gradually decreases as you walk around (as the muscular tissues warm up).
If you experience inflammation or swelling or heat emitting from arc of the foot or inside edge of the heel.
If when you stroll it seems like there is a pebble in your footwear pressing versus your heel.
The moment your feet experience discomfort, it is very important to look for specialist, medical help. Experiencing via Plantar Fasciitis pain can lead to a chronic problem that will certainly get worse gradually.

Exactly How Is Plantar Fasciitis Treated?

Rest
Ice
Massage (with ice on the arc of the foot).
Take in cold water or cold bathroom.
Encouraging inserts, evening splints and/or heel pads.
Physical treatment.
Extending and also strengthening exercises morning and also night.
Over-the-counter drugs such as Advil, Tylenol or Aleve to decrease swelling and relieve pain.
Steroid shot (temporary relief and also just in severe cases).
Electric existing.
Surgery (rare).
